Abstract: In a method for slit radiography a fan-shaped X-ray beam scans a body to form an X-ray shadow image. The fan-shaped beam is formed by a number of sectors situated next to each other. For each sector the transmitted X-ray radiation is controlled instantaneously during a scan by means of controllable beam sector modulators. The X-ray radiation is cyclically modulated in a predetermined manner for all the sectors taken together. The controllable beam sector modulators are individually controlled to select cyclically and in synchronism with the predetermined cyclic modulation a part of the X-ray radiation for each sector.

Abstract: An image pickup device comprises a matrix of rows and columns of image pickup elements. Image information is transferred in the column direction in the time-delay-and-integration mode. Each column comprises at least two regions containing image pickup elements, whereby spectrally different images can be picked up during a single scan.
Abstract: An image pickup device comprises a matrix of rows and columns of image pickup elements. Image information is transferred in the column direction in the time-delay-and-integration mode. Two shift registers are associated with each column of image pickup elements. During a first period information from the image pickup elements of each column is transferred to a first one of each two shift registers associated with each column and during a second period information is transferred to the second one of each two shift registers associated with each column.Such an image pickup device can be used in radiography as a means for detecting x-ray radiation transmitted by a body under examination. In order to obtain a dual energy image a first or a second spectral center point is periodically imparted to the x-ray radiation synchronously with the first and second periods.

Abstract: The gas rate sensor in the present invention is provided with a holder assembly having a metallic holding portion for holding flow sensors and a cylindrical casing containing the holder assembly and heater wires which are wound around the outside thereof. The outer periphery of the holding portion is provided with a plural number of projections which are brought into compressive contact with the inner periphery of the casing for enabling pressing of the holder assembly into the casing. A temperature detection element is disposed in a gas flow passage between the holder assembly and the casing for performing energizing control of the heater wires.
